Output 850dccee18dbb76df6fc8ee6ba915feb9fd10b9986b6c2cb2619ab306f64154a:1

value
5629560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18146d278e77aaff201c723de3bd625ab85ffff2 OP_EQUAL
address
MA6UvHSMuQzQhECUjedBYZxWYBmBeNgjEN
transaction
850dccee18dbb76df6fc8ee6ba915feb9fd10b9986b6c2cb2619ab306f64154a
spent
true